ShareSOUTH MISSISSIPPI (WLOX) - The WLOX First Alert Weather Team is tracking Major Hurricane Milton. On Tuesday, Milton remained a powerful major hurricane in the Gulf of Mexico near the tip of the Yucatan Peninsula. Milton has its sights set on Florida. A major hurricane landfall is expected by late tomorrow or early Thursday. Places on Florida’s Gulf Coast between Cape Coral, Tampa, and Homosassa Springs are at risk for a direct hit from the core and eyewall of the storm.

SOUTH MISSISSIPPI (WLOX) - Tropical Storm Ernesto formed Monday afternoon in the Atlantic, just east of the Lesser Antilles. The WLOX First Alert Weather Team will continue to track Ernesto as it enters the Caribbean. Forecast models are in agreement that Ernesto will strengthen as it moves into a favorable environment near the Lesser Antilles and Puerto Rico this week. The forecast from the National Hurricane Center shows it becoming a hurricane by the end of the week.
